Prior to Installation:
Make sure you have all necessary parts by checking the diagram and parts list. If any part is missing or damaged, please contact Kraus Customer Service at 800-775-0703 for a replacement
Turn o the cold and hot water at the angle stops and turn on the old faucet to release any built up pressure
Flush angle stops to release any debris prior to installation
Pre-drilled hole size requirement: 1-3/8” (min) – 1-1/2” (max)
Max countertop thickness: 1-3/8
1, 2, or 3 hole installation
Tools Required
Adjustable Wrench
Safety Goggles
Bucket
Silicone Sealant

Care & Maintenance
*To keep the product clean & shining, follow the steps below:
1. Rinse with clean water & dry with a soft cloth
2. Do not clean with soaps, acid, polish, abrasives, or harsh cleaners
3. Do not use cloth with a coarse surface
4. Unscrew the aerator and clean when necessary

Trouble - Shooting
If you have followed the instructions carefully and your faucet still does not work
properly, take the following corrective steps:
PROBLEM CAUSE ACTION
Leakage under faucet handle
Water does not shut off completely
Leaking between spray head and the hose
Locking nut has come loose or cartridge needs to be reseated
Cartridge may need to be adjusted or replaced
Spray head may be loose or washer is not seated correctly in the hose connection
Remove button located at top of handle. Loosen set screw with hex wrench. Remove handle and unscrew cartridge cover by hand. Tighten locking nut with an adjustable wrench
Remove button located at top of handle. Loosen set screw with hex wrench. Remove handle and unscrew cartridge cover by hand. Unscrew locking nut with an adjustable wrench. Remove ceramic disc cartridge. Check for cracks, and if O-ring is seated correctly. Reseat cartridge
Tighten spray head by hand until snug. Make sure washer is seated correctly
Hose does not retract Weight may be
installed incorrectly
Low flow Aerator may be clogged Unscrew aerator with
Readjust weight on hose
aerator key. Hold tip of spray head and turn on water to flush debris

Maintenance - Cartridge Replacement
Step 1: Remove button
located at the top of the
handle. Loosen the set
screw with a hex wrench.
Remove the handle and
unscrew cartridge cover by
hand
Step 2: Unscrew the
locking nut with an
adjustable wrench. Remove
ceramic disc cartridge
Step 3: Place the new
cartridge in the handle
seat. Secure the cartridge
with the locking nut and
assemble the handle
